A Taste of Home Far From Home: Popeyes Opens at Camp Arifjan

Camp Arifjan Popeyes

The Exchange opened a Popeyes Louisiana Kitchen at Camp Arifjan in Kuwait.

More than 550 service members at Camp Arifjan lined up to get a taste of home Feb. 9, when the Exchange opened a Popeyes restaurant at the Kuwait installation.

The restaurant is the fifth Exchange Popeyes at a contingency location, and the 87th Exchange Popeyes worldwide.

“Eating at a familiar favorite may seem like a small thing, but it’s a huge morale boost for service members serving overseas,” said Jason Rosenberg, Exchange senior vice president of the Europe/Southwest Asia Region. “The Exchange is dedicated to making life better for our heroes, and bringing name-brand restaurants to them, wherever they are, is one small way we do that.”

Popeyes is already a big hit at Camp Arifjan—the restaurant did more than $7,000 in sales its first day.
